Quarterly Planning Note — Finance Team

We received the revised term sheet from Ostrev Holdings on Tuesday. Payment terms shift to quarterly instalments, and the exclusivity clause now lapses after eighteen months. Model both scenarios before the planning session with Director Halm. Context matters here: the term sheet connects to a wider plan still under wraps. That plan is summarised confidentially below.

board note of kageg-bahof: The renewal with Holwynax Holdings closes at $2 million a year, 5 percent below the last contract. Project Ulaath slips by two quarters because of the supplier delay.

### Blue-green deploy: billing worker

The Tallyforge billing worker deploys blue-green only. Never roll it in place — in-flight invoice batches cannot survive a restart mid-cycle. Drain the active color, confirm the queue depth hits zero, then flip traffic and watch error rates for ten minutes before decommissioning the old color. Rollback is a reverse flip, nothing more. Step-by-step commands and the drain checklist live on the page below.

wiki page, bawef-hafop: https://jira.nelvroworks.corp/job/pages/projects/7c5c0f440dbd

## Idempotency Keys for Payment Retries (Lumopay)

Every retry of a charge request must reuse the original idempotency key; generating a new key on retry can produce duplicate charges. Keys are scoped per merchant and expire after 48 hours. Reviewers should verify keys are derived server-side, never from client input. The full key-generation specification and threat model are maintained on the internal page.

dashboard of kaguf-tawip = https://vault.merlaqsys.test/issue